java数据库需要学到什么程度

fiy 其他 8

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    学习Java数据库需要掌握以下几个方面:

    1. SQL语言:学习SQL语言是使用数据库的基础。SQL是结构化查询语言,用于管理和操作关系型数据库。掌握SQL语言包括对数据表的创建、插入、更新、删除等操作,以及对数据的查询、排序、过滤等。

    2. 数据库管理系统(DBMS):了解不同的数据库管理系统,如MySQL、Oracle、SQL Server等。掌握数据库的安装、配置、备份和恢复等基本操作。

    3. JDBC(Java Database Connectivity):JDBC是Java提供的用于访问数据库的API。学习JDBC可以实现与数据库的连接、执行SQL语句、处理结果集等操作。掌握JDBC的使用可以实现Java程序与数据库的交互。

    4. ORM框架:ORM(Object-Relational Mapping)框架可以将Java对象映射到数据库中的表,实现对象和数据库的转换。学习ORM框架如Hibernate、MyBatis等可以简化开发过程,提高效率。

    5. 数据库设计和优化:了解数据库的设计原则和规范,学习如何设计表结构、定义关系、设置索引等。同时,学习数据库的性能优化技巧,如索引优化、查询优化等,以提高数据库的性能和响应速度。

    总结来说,学习Java数据库需要掌握SQL语言、数据库管理系统、JDBC、ORM框架以及数据库设计和优化等知识。这些知识将帮助你理解和使用数据库,实现Java程序与数据库的交互,并优化数据库的性能。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学习Java数据库需要掌握的内容包括以下几个方面:

    1. SQL语言:作为与数据库交互的基础,学习SQL语言是必须的。掌握SQL语法,包括数据查询、插入、更新和删除等操作,以及数据定义语言(DDL)和数据控制语言(DCL)等。

    2. 数据库管理系统(DBMS):了解常见的数据库管理系统,如MySQL、Oracle、SQL Server等,并熟悉其特点和使用方法。掌握数据库的安装、配置、备份和恢复等操作。

    3. JDBC(Java Database Connectivity):JDBC是Java连接数据库的标准API,学习JDBC可以实现Java程序与数据库之间的交互。了解JDBC的基本使用方法,包括连接数据库、执行SQL语句、处理结果集等。

    4. ORM(Object Relational Mapping)框架:ORM框架可以将数据库中的表映射为Java对象,简化了数据库操作。学习常见的ORM框架,如Hibernate、MyBatis等,了解其基本概念和使用方法。

    5. 数据库设计与优化:学习数据库设计的基本原则和规范,包括数据表的设计、关系的建立、索引的使用等。了解数据库的性能优化方法,包括索引优化、SQL语句优化等。

    6. 事务处理:了解事务的概念和特性,学习事务的管理方法。掌握事务的提交、回滚、隔离级别等操作。

    7. 数据库安全性:学习数据库的安全性管理,包括用户权限管理、数据加密、防止SQL注入等。了解数据库的备份与恢复、容灾与高可用等方面的知识。

    除了以上内容,还可以学习一些高级的数据库技术,如分布式数据库、NoSQL数据库、大数据存储与处理等,以满足不同场景下的需求。

    总之,学习Java数据库需要掌握SQL语言、数据库管理系统、JDBC、ORM框架等基本知识,同时还需了解数据库设计、优化、事务处理、安全性等方面的内容。通过不断的实践和深入学习,可以不断提升在Java数据库开发领域的能力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学习Java数据库需要掌握以下几个方面的知识:

    1. Java编程基础:在学习Java数据库之前,需要掌握Java的基本语法和编程概念,包括变量、数据类型、循环、条件语句、函数等基础知识。

    2. SQL语言:SQL是结构化查询语言,是与数据库进行交互的标准语言。学习Java数据库需要熟悉SQL语言的基本语法,包括创建表、插入数据、查询数据、更新数据、删除数据等操作。

    3. 数据库基础知识:了解数据库的基本概念和原理,包括关系型数据库和非关系型数据库的区别、表、字段、主键、外键等概念。掌握数据库的设计原则和范式,能够设计合理的数据库结构。

    4. JDBC:Java数据库连接(JDBC)是Java提供的连接数据库的标准接口。学习Java数据库需要熟悉JDBC的使用,包括连接数据库、执行SQL语句、处理结果集等操作。

    5. 数据库连接池:数据库连接是一种资源,创建和释放连接会消耗一定的系统资源。为了提高数据库访问的性能,可以使用数据库连接池技术。学习Java数据库需要了解数据库连接池的原理和使用方法。

    6. ORM框架:对象关系映射(ORM)框架可以将数据库表和Java对象之间进行映射,简化数据库操作。学习Java数据库需要了解常用的ORM框架,如Hibernate、MyBatis等,并掌握其使用方法。

    7. 数据库安全:学习Java数据库还需要了解数据库安全相关知识,包括SQL注入、权限管理、加密算法等,以保护数据库的安全性。

    总结起来,学习Java数据库需要掌握Java编程基础、SQL语言、数据库基础知识、JDBC、数据库连接池、ORM框架和数据库安全等知识。只有掌握了这些知识,才能够熟练地使用Java与数据库进行交互,并开发出高效、安全的数据库应用程序。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部